The New York Stock Exchange and Nasdaq will open normal hours on Monday, October 14, for Columbus Day and Indigenous Peoples Day.

Key insights

  • Next Monday, October 14th, is Columbus Day, a federal holiday.

  • Stock and bond markets typically follow the federal holiday schedule, but the New York Stock Exchange and Nasdaq will have normal hours on Monday.

  • However, the bond markets as well as many banks and government institutions such as the post office will remain closed.

This year, October 14th is the second Monday in October, the day on which Columbus Day is celebrated in the United States. This means you may be wondering whether the stock markets will be open for trading.

Considering that the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) and Nasdaq largely follow the federal closure holiday calendar, it might be a surprise that both will be open and operating normally on Monday.

The two remaining holidays on the exchanges’ respective 2024 calendars are Thanksgiving and Christmas, with additional reduced hours the day after Thanksgiving and Christmas Eve.

However, federal operations such as the Federal Reserve and post offices will be closed, as will commercial banks that are following the federal holiday schedule. The bond markets are also closed.
